Once again: If you want to reduce illegal immigration, prosecute those who hire them. Illegals come to this country for jobs. Prosecute those who hire them and the jobs will disappear. Illegals will stop coming. Wages will rise, at least somewhat. -Note: prosecuting those who break the law does not rule out a guest worker program. - However, if you really WANT illegals to come here, in order to supply cheap labor, but you don’t want to SAY that’s what you want, then yes, continue to demand an ever higher fence along the southern border. Such a fence will not be effective and even if it were, it would affect only illegals from Mexico, no other countries.
